they started ignoring the treaty of versailles after hitler rose to power. I think the point is hitler wouldn't have rose to power without , say, weimar hyperinflation.

I agree totally.  
But the reason I said that WW2 and Iraq are separate is because of one other big difference:

Germany had a government military that was defeated.

In Iraq, not so simple: while their military was defeated,  repeated attacks by irregular insurgent forces are causing the hyperinflation and the drain on their economy.  

And this is the major difference betwen Iraq and WW2 w\regard to the economic damage:

Germany's inflation was caused by post WW1 treaties aimed at politically motivated revenge after hostilities ceased.

Iraq's economic destruction, however, is the result of ongoing post war non-government insurgent actions specifically aimed at derailing the peace process with the West as it causes an economic drain as a side effect.

The same outcome, yes, but through different political reasons. Hope that helps.  Cheers
